Thank you. This is pretty clearly the problem:

> The webmail.bellaliant.net server is sniffing for "Firefox".  This is
> invalid.  If sniffing can be justified at all, the site should be
> sniffing for "Gecko".  For an explanation of "sniffing", see my
> <http://www.rossde.com/internet/Webdevelopers.html#sniff>. 

I will tell BellAliant that. I'd hope they'd be interested. But of 
course the userbase of Seamonkey users is probably pretty small, from 
their point of view.
